Lock Your PHP Site Away From Hackers! 4 Essential Tips

Entrepreneurs everywhere are making great use of PHP’s impressive capabilities to develop dynamic and mind-blowing websites. 

PHP is the right technology to use if you wish to make a statement upon your arrival in the market. And this fact is known to almost every developer as well as business owners dealing with technical projects. 

This is why PHP backs up around 79% of active websites on the internet. Therefore, famous brands such as Yahoo, Wikipedia, WordPress, Facebook, Tumblr, and many others are coded in PHP. Companies use the technology to code even the smallest to the most massive project dealing with enormous data transfer each day. 

Thus, they prefer to look for PHP developers for hire whenever a project is coming up next. 

What is PHP?

PHP, also known as the “General Purpose Programming Language,” was developed by a Danish-Canadian programmers Rasmus Lerdorf in 1994. The language facilitates the easy operations of a website’s back-end. 

It initially aimed at monitoring and regulating traffic on Rasmus’s personal resume. Thus, it stood for “Person Home Page.”

However, as technology evolved, more comprehensive changes were brought to the scripting language, making it even more advanced and smart. 

PHP is now an acronym of “Hypertext Processor” and is used to develop any size of a website, be it small and basic or massive and complex. 

Currently, PHP has managed to become one-stop for all the development related needs. It offers various solutions to ensure your project is delivered within the right time frame with the right features and capabilities. 

Advantages of using PHP:

Using PHP for your project is an advantageous deal. That’s not just our claim, but many big brands are proof of it! 

  • It is free of cost and open-source
  • Supported by almost all operating systems such as Windows, Linux, Unit, etc.
  • Simple to learn, accessible to code
  • Makes an easy and secure connection to the database
  • It is one of the fastest scripting languages out in the market
  • Facilitates easy web development and automatic maintenance
  • Has a robust community to provide support
  • PHP based apps can be easily tested
  • Stable in comparison to others
  • Offers built-in tools and features for proper website security. 

Now that it is clear that PHP offers an abundance of benefits to whoever that develops their project with it. It is smart to start your next project with its incredible power. 

However, there is one thing you need to focus the most on. And that’s providing efficient security to your website and ensuring that no hacker can ever get their way into your precious data. 

But how to make that happen? 

All you have to do is start looking for PHP coders for hire because PHP is the one solution to all your security-related doubts. 

Along with your developer, set a higher bar for your application by not compromising your site’s data. 

Let’s protect your website from web attacks! Know all there is to know:

Session Hijacking:

Session hijacking is an ill-intentioned attack in which the hacker makes amends to secretly get the possession of the user’s session ID.

The session ID is then forwarded to the server, where it is validated by the associated session line-up with the stored data in the stacks, thus providing the hacker away into your app.

The malicious attack is backed by XSS attacks or when a hacker gets her/his way into the folder containing all session data.

To counter such attacks, you must look for PHP programmers for hire who can excellently execute the data session binding to your users’ IP address.

Prevent SQL Injection Attacks:

The most common attack your PHP website can be exposed to is the SQL injections. 

A single SQL query can put in jeopardy your whole application. 

These attacks are carried out by hackers who aim to modify the data that you pass via queries. What often happens is that the owner gives the data in SQL queries, and a hacker utilizes various characteristics to bypass it. 

In such cases, the hacker can alter your data to harm your database. There are also possibilities of your database getting deleted if injected a malicious characteristic. 

To counter any such situations, you must always use PDO, which stands for PHP Data Objects, to ensure your website’s security from any SQL injections. Proper implementation can be carried out by looking for PHP coders for hire to provide security layers on your website.

Cross-site request forgery (CSRF):

CSRF is capable of handing over the total control of your website into the hands of a hacker. Thus, s/he can perform any malicious attack smoothly. These malicious operations may include injecting an infected code into the site, leading to functional modification, data theft, etc. 

This attack forces the user to change the formal request into a modified destructive one, such as deleting all of the databases unknowingly, transferring funds without any knowledge of it, etc. There is only one way to initiate this attack: sending the user a malicious link; this link can be the host of such attacks upon a users’ click. 

This implies a smart business owner would never become prey to such attacks. If you know how to identify the link, you will know where not to click. 

Meanwhile, you can also integrate two protective measures to provide your website the security wall it needs; this can be done using only the GET request from your URL and making sure that only the client-side code generates the non-GET request.

Always use SSL Certificates:

You need to obtain an end to end data transmission with proper security while developing your website over the internet. Therefore, you must look for PHP programmers for hire and make sure you use SSL certificates in your technology. It is a security standard protocol used worldwide and known as Hypertext Transfer Protocol (HTTPS). The HTTPS securely transfers the data between the servers. 

You can build a secure data transfer pathway using an SSL certificate, through which it becomes impossible for hackers to pave their way into your app. 

Conclusion:

A PHP website can gain massive popularity in a little while. Therefore, advanced popularity makes it more vulnerable to external attacks. But you can ensure to develop a safe and sound website by fortifying it against such malicious threats just by keeping in mind the points mentioned above. 

You can simply look for PHP developers for hire and responsibility to safeguard your website’s data and make it error-free.

Author
Experienced Developer with a demonstrated history of working in the field of E-commerce using Magento and WooCommerce and vue storefront. Skilled in PHP and JavaScript. Did B.C.A in Computer Science and pursuing M.C.A from Indira Gandhi National Open University.